Spend the day with us enjoying pours from some of Southern California’s favorite craft breweries, great eats from local food vendors, a curated artisan market, and a full lineup of country, and Americana music. We’re also raising a glass to support our local charities thru the Westlake Village Rotary Club and the Ventura County Fireman’s Widows & Orphans Fund — it’s going to be a good one.

What to Bring

A valid, government-issued photo ID with your birth date (no photocopies — no exceptions)

Please Leave These at Home

  • Outside food or drinks
  • High-back chairs (must be 35” or lower)
  • Glass of any kind
  • Drugs or illegal substances
  • Coolers, wagons, strollers, or water bottles (complimentary water provided on-site)
  • Camelbacks or water bladders
  • Bikes, skateboards, scooters, rollerblades, or motorized vehicles
  • Weapons of any kind
  • Fireworks or sparklers
  • Professional camera gear (no detachable lenses, tripods, drones, GoPros, etc.)
  • Umbrellas
  • Water guns, balloons, or projectiles
  • Unauthorized vending or handouts
  • Pets (service animals welcome)

You’re Good to Bring

  • Low-back chair (35” or under) or a small blanket/beach towel (max 8’x8’) — one per person
  • Prescribed medication (original container with matching ID and doctor’s note)
  • Small bags, purses, or fanny packs
  • Sealed gum or ChapStick
  • Sunglasses, hats, sunscreen

Kids Policy

Children 10 and under get in free with a paid adult. Anyone 11 and up will need a ticket. Parents are responsible for supervising their kids at all times. If you’re bringing little ones, we strongly recommend having a designated adult focused on them — and don’t forget ear protection, as live music can get loud.

Re-Entry

Yes, you’re free to come and go up till 3pm. After 3pm, there will be no re-entry. Wristbands are non-transferable and won’t be replaced if removed.
